I wrote that garlic is hot in the mouth, when raw and crushed, and that Garlic is a blood thinner, and if you are on Blood Thinning Medication, you dont add more to that, without talking to your Doctor.

Its the same with Vitamin K.

The growing use of herbal medicines: issues relating to adverse reactions and challenges in monitoring safety
The general perception that herbal remedies or drugs are very safe and devoid of adverse effects is not only untrue, but also misleading. Herbs have been shown to be capable of producing a wide range of undesirable or adverse reactions some of which are capable of causing serious injuries, life-threatening conditions, and even death
